noun an actor who communicates entirely by gesture and facial expression
noun a performance using gestures and body movements without words
verb imitate (a person or manner), especially for satirical effect
originPossibly from Middle English *mime, from Old English mīma (“a buffoon, jester, mime”), from Latin mimus, from Ancient Greek μῖμος (mîmos, “imitator, actor”), but more likely re-borrowed in modern times from French mime (“mimic actor”), from the same source.
